To plate a bit of jewelry, a jeweler layers rhodium plating of a specific thickness about another metallic. It must be the right thickness to maintain it from cracking, which is normally amongst .75-one.0 microns. A thinner layer lets the steel underneath to indicate, plus a thicker layer would crack.

White gold is frequently plated with a skinny rhodium layer to boost its visual appearance, even though sterling silver is frequently rhodium-plated to resist tarnishing. Not all jewelry is rhodium plated. All reliable white gold jewelry is rhodium plated, but only Another treasured metals are. Jewelry which is white gold plated also has rhodium, as well as some sterling silver jewelry.

Rhodium finds use in jewelry and for decorations. It is actually electroplated on white gold and platinum to offer it a reflective white surface area[forty seven] at time of sale, after which The skinny layer wears absent with use. This is called rhodium flashing during the jewelry business enterprise. It could also be Utilized in coating sterling silver to guard towards tarnish (silver sulfide, Ag2S, produced from atmospheric hydrogen sulfide, H2S).

It is really challenging to notify how long rhodium plating lasts on jewelry. The common time period is said being around 12 months, but has also been for a longer time.
